About Saidupur Village
Saidupur is a small village in Nakodar tehsil, in the district of Jalandhar, Punjab.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 464, made up of 231 males and 233 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,009 females per 1000 males. The village covers 124 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 144630,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Saidupur
The census records public bus service for Saidupur as Available within <5 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within <5 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
